交换机是计算机网络中的一种设备,用于在局域网(LAN)中转发数据包。其职能和作用如下:
1.包转发:交换机通过查看包的目的MAC地址,将包从源端口转发到目的端口,从而实现局域网内的数据通信。可以根据MAC地址建立转发表,记录MAC地址和端口的对应关系,提高数据传输效率。
2.广播和多播过滤:交换机可以识别广播和多播数据包,并将它们仅转发到需要接收这些数据包的端口,而不是将它们广播到所有端口。这有助于减少网络流量并提高网络性能。
3.冲突域隔离:交换机将每个端口划分为一个独立的冲突域,这意味着数据包只会在目标端口上发送和接收,不会在其他端口上造成冲突。这提高了网络可靠性和传输效率。
4.网络分割与隔离:通过将交换机连接到不同的VLAN(虚拟局域网),可以将网络划分为若干个逻辑上独立的子网,实现不同部门、用户或安全级别之间的隔离和安全。
5.端口速度和双工模式匹配:交换机的每个端口都可以根据连接设备的速度和双工模式进行配置,以确保最佳的数据传输性能。它可以自动适应不同设备的速度和双工模式,提供最佳的通信质量。
6.QoS(服务质量)支持:交换机可以支持QoS功能,通过数据包的优先级标记和流量控制,为关键应用提供更高的带宽和更低的延迟,从而保证网络服务质量的均衡和优化。
总之,交换机在局域网中起着连接和转发数据的作用,能够提供高性能、可靠、安全的数据通信。它是构建现代计算机网络的重要组成部分。
评论前必须登录!
注册